APC Crisis: Former lawmaker cautions APC over Gov. Buni's removal , says, he Deserves Better Treatment from party


Rt. Hon. Goni Buka

By JOE Hemba

A former Member of House of Representatives  from  Yobe State Rt. Honorable Goni Bukar popularly known as BUGON said  Gov. Mai Mala Buni deserves a better treatment from the ruling  All Progressive Congress(APC) than what is playing out at the moment.

According to the former Lawmaker, the people of Yobe, despite the current happenings at the leadership of the party still remain proud of Gov. Mai Mala’s achievements in stabilising the party and setting it on a sound footing for the next general election come  2023.

BUGON who spoke with journalists in Damaturu on Friday called on the APC to be more honorable in handling the leadership crisis than the way they are going about it.

The APC under Gov. Buni he noted has attained greater success and unprecedented  unity which the party cannot afford to compromise within a few days to her  national convention.


“The events that have befell our dear political party, the All Progressive Congress theses few days culminating to leadership struggle has left much to be desired.

“As Muslims, we all believe that  divinity of leaders is  a function of the act of Allah. Just like life, He is the giver of leadership and He alone can take it when He so desires, nonetheless, the vaulting ambition of men especially in Nigeria has clearly demonstrated man’s quest for power and position not minding the qur’anic injunction.

“Every member of our great party has no doubt in the capacity of Gov. Buni in the running of the affairs of this party since he took over as the Acting Chairman. Gov. Buni in all sense of respect, dedication  and honesty has executed this national assignment with all intent and purposes to the admiration of all party members.

“Through his political craftsmanship Gov. Buni has made the APC , which was almost a sinking ship when he took over the most attractive party in the country.  He has cleverly  silenced the opposition PDP whom he recruited  three  serving Governors from their ranks, two former Speakers of the House of Representatives and several other personalities across the country,” BUGON said.

Rt. Hon.Goni  Bukar, reminded those calling for Buni’s head not to forget easily how the party begged him to come and rescue it when it was in complete ruins some few years ago.

“In 2020, when the APC  was in complete disarray,  submerged in  leadership crises and confusion at  all levels, the President and the party  knew Gov. Buni  was the only Nigerian Politician with  the  requisite capacity of rebuilding the party. They begged him to take the job  and to the glory of Allah, he has done that fantastically  well with  all passion and energy. We are proud of the APC today because of his work. Our confidence as a political party in retaining power in 2023 lies on Gov. Buni’s landmark work for the party,” BUGON stated.

While giving a vote of confidence on Gov. Buni’s performance as the governor of Yobe State and justifying why the people of Yobe are solidly behind their governor, Hon. Bukar enumerated various developmental projects Gov. Buni has embarked on in the last few year which he not noted are public oriented and demand driven particularly in Housing, Health, Commerce, Agriculture, education etc.


“We, the people of Yobe State  stand with our governor and  the party 100%.  As sons and daughters of Yobe, we  will continue to rally round our governor as well as  our resolve and trust in our dear party, the APC, we shall surely  enjoy victory across Nigeria come 2023. Despite the fact that  disagreements will never end in human endeavor, it’s no gainsaying that the APC as the largest and ruling political party will be an exception. We however want to caution that decent and honorable measures should be used to solving such disagreement rather than engaging in reckless antics that will take us back to the dark era of the party,” BUGUN advised.
